Prelims Strategy

To excel in NEET questions on lenses, a robust strategy involves several key aspects. Firstly, master sign conventions (Cartesian system) thoroughly. This is the most common source of error in numerical problems.

Always draw a mental (or actual) diagram to visualize the direction of light and measure distances accordingly. Secondly, memorize and understand the lens formula (rac1v1u=1frac{1}{v} - \frac{1}{u} = \frac{1}{f}) and the magnification formula (m=vu=hhm = \frac{v}{u} = \frac{h'}{h}).

Practice applying these with correct signs for u,v,fu, v, f. Thirdly, understand the Lens Maker's Formula (rac{1}{f} = (\frac{n_2}{n_1} - 1) left( \frac{1}{R_1} - \frac{1}{R_2} \right)) and its implications, especially how focal length changes with the surrounding medium.

Fourthly, practice problems on combinations of lenses, both in contact (Peq=P1+P2P_{eq} = P_1 + P_2) and separated by a distance (Peq=P1+P2dP1P2P_{eq} = P_1 + P_2 - dP_1P_2). Finally, for conceptual questions, be able to quickly recall image characteristics (real/virtual, erect/inverted, magnified/diminished) for different object positions for both convex and concave lenses.

Ray diagrams, though not directly asked, are excellent tools for conceptual clarity and verifying answers. Pay attention to units, especially converting focal length to meters for power calculations.
